xMetian Posted September 2, 2010 Share Posted September 2, 2010 I perhaps found a better way to download the patches with a better speed. Make sure you have launched the launcher first, let it update for 30 secs, then close it. Then Go to "My Documents" Open the folder named: "My Games" Open the folder named: "FINAL FANTASY XIV Beta Version" Open the folder named: "downloads" Open the folder named: "ffxiv-beta" Open the folder named: "d96437e6" Then you should find 2 folders, metainfo and patch, in the meta info there should be some torrents, you can use those to download them with an torrent-program. Don't forget to save the .patch files in patch folder in d96437e6 When you're done, start the updater and it should take a couple of minutes and it should download then. Don't forget to save the .patch files in patch folder in d96437e6 They download a .patch file, so I assume those are the patches, not 100% sure, but it looks like it. Still downloading 2 patches ( 538mb and 1,2GB ). But alot faster then the 'update' Edit #1 - I get almost 1MB/s with the 538mb, but the 1.23GB is kinda slow, 100-200kb/s, but not sure if that is because I download 2 files.
